/** Set the current position of the motor.
* \param[in] position The new absolute motor position that should be set in the hardware. Units=steps.*/
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setPosition(double position)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the current encoder position of the motor.
* \param[in] position The new absolute encoder position that should be set in the hardware. Units=steps.*/
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setEncoderPosition(double position)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the high limit position of the motor.
* \param[in] highLimit The new high limit position that should be set in the hardware. Units=steps.*/
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setHighLimit(double highLimit)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the low limit position of the motor.
* \param[in] lowLimit The new low limit position that should be set in the hardware. Units=steps.*/
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setLowLimit(double lowLimit)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the proportional gain of the motor.
* \param[in] pGain The new proportional gain. */
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setPGain(double pGain)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the integral gain of the motor.
* \param[in] iGain The new integral gain. */
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setIGain(double iGain)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the derivative gain of the motor.
* \param[in] pGain The new derivative gain. */
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setDGain(double dGain)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the motor closed loop status.
* \param[in] closedLoop true = close loop, false = open looop. */
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setClosedLoop(bool closedLoop)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
/** Set the motor encoder ratio.
* \param[in] ratio The new encoder ratio */
asynStatus asynMotorAxis::setEncoderRatio(double ratio)
{
return asynSuccess;
}
